OK, so you made it through another summer without a spa. But how about next year? Now is probably the best time to check out the prices since, as any good bargain shopper knows, buying out of season usually leads to the best deals.

There’s a factory outlet in Canoga Park where three manufacturers of spas are represented and where the regular cost carries a healthy discount. L.A. Spas, Majestic and Charisma are all Southern California companies that make up the inventory at Hydro Spa, where close to 25 models are on display.

A four-person spa from Charisma that retails for $3,100 is marked $2,495. From Majestic is another four-person spa, 6-foot round, that regularly sells for $2,995--and sells here for $2,495. You can save $1,000 on an 8-foot spa by Chalet that holds six to seven people and retails for $4,995; reduced price is $3,995.

Unlike other spa outlets where demos and home-show models are marked down and you have to take whatever color and sizes are on the floor, at Hydro Spa there is a choice of several colors and immediate delivery.

In addition--and this is a big plus--installation is included in the price, along with steps and a cover. All this, plus there’s a service warranty of five years on the equipment and 20 years on the shell itself.

The day I checked there were also about six gazebos on the floor, ranging in price from $800 to $3,000 and reflecting a discount of 20% to 25% off original retail.

All the spa covers are made by Ideal; currently on the floor is a $325 model reduced to $224.

Hydra Spa will hold any item for 90 days with a $100 deposit, and if you change your mind, they’ll refund the whole deposit.
